Would you like to have your say on fertility issues?
HFEA, the UK regulator of fertility treatment, and Ipsos MORI, the well-known opinion research organisation, are seeking your views on fertility treatment to inform the continuing improvement of services for people going through fertility treatment.
We are looking for people who are having or have had fertility treatment to take part over the next year and beyond.
